Hanabi is most vulnerable in the early game, where counters average a 62.2% win rate. As the match progresses, Hanabi becomes harder to shut down (54.9% mid, 49.8% late). Prioritize early aggression and ganks to build an advantage before Hanabi can scale.

The best counters for Hanabi in MLBB are Beatrix, Ixia, Hanzo. These heroes have the highest matchup win rates against Hanabi based on ranked data. Pick any of them to gain a statistical advantage in draft.
Hanabi performs best against Khufra, Popol and Kupa, Akai. In these matchups, Hanabi has a significant win rate advantage. Consider picking Hanabi when you see these heroes on the enemy team.
